Betting Exchanges and Their Advantages

Betting exchanges function uniquely from traditional bookmakers by allowing users to bet against each other rather than against the house. These services offer distinct advantages for punters seeking better value and more control over their wagers.

  • Establish your own betting lines and wait for others to match them
  • Lay bets against outcomes you think won’t happen
  • Typically offer superior odds than conventional bookmakers
  • Trade stakes throughout live events for gains
  • Gain access to higher stake limits on major events

While betting exchanges can offer superior value, they require a commission on winning bets rather than incorporating margins into pricing. Understanding how betting sites using the exchange model function is essential before committing funds, as the peer-to-peer nature means liquidity can vary significantly across different markets and events.

Analyzing Odds, Promotions and Payout Methods

When assessing different platforms, three key elements require consideration: odds availability, promotional incentives, and financial transaction methods. The odds competitiveness directly impacts your potential returns, whilst promotional offers and welcome packages can significantly enhance your bankroll. Understanding how different betting sites organize payment methods ensures you can deposit and withdraw funds smoothly, with fast transaction speeds and low charges that suit your financial preferences.

Feature What to Look For Why It Matters Red Flags
Odds Quality Competitive margins, enhanced pricing, best odds guaranteed Higher odds mean superior potential returns on winning wagers Consistently poor odds versus other bookmakers
Welcome Bonuses Fair rollover requirements (under 10x), transparent conditions Extra funds to test the service and increase betting capital Excessive rollover requirements, limiting terms
Ongoing Promotions Frequent promotions, rewards programs, boosted odds, cashback Sustained benefits for regular customers outside first deposit Limited promotions, weak rewards rewards
Payment Methods Various methods including digital wallets, credit cards, direct transfers Easy access and choice for deposits and withdrawals Few methods, excessive charges, delayed transaction times

Reviewing the terms and conditions attached to bonuses is crucial, as eye-catching promotional offers can mask unfavourable wagering requirements. Many betting sites impose conditions that prevent easy withdrawal of bonus money.

Payment options has become increasingly important for UK punters who value fast receipt of their winnings. The best betting sites offer diverse withdrawal methods with withdrawal speeds below 24 hours for e-wallets and competitive limits.

How can I assess if a betting site is legitimate and secure?

Verify a UK Gambling Commission licence number visible in the footer of the website, which you can verify on the Commission’s official register. Legitimate operators betting sites use SSL encryption (indicated by a padlock icon in your browser), prominently show their terms and conditions, provide accepted payment methods, and have transparent policies for player protection. Check third-party reviews, check how long the operator has been operating, and verify they have accessible customer service channels before depositing funds.
